共查询到20条相似文献,搜索用时 140 毫秒
1.
2.
3.
DSP与PC机间的串行通讯 总被引:1,自引:0,他引:1
利用PC(Personal Computer)机实现对DSP(Digital Signal Processing)的实现检测与控制,保证了PC机与DSP间的稳定,迅速的通讯。通过一个可变幅值和频率的正弦波生成程序的例子,详细阐述了如何实现DSP与PC机间的串行通讯,使用面向对象语言VC++6.0作为开发工具,以及利用DSP中的SCI(Serial Communication Interface)模块,来实现DSP与微机间的指令和数据传递,程序软件已在PC机和TMS320F240评估板上调试通过,其结果令人满意。 相似文献
4.
5.
6.
7.
DSP指令集仿真器的设计与实现 总被引:3,自引:1,他引:2
指令集仿真器是进行芯片设计评估,系统软件设计开发以及计算机软硬件协同设计的不可或缺的工具.在DSP的硬件设计和后期算法开发中,指令集仿真器也同样是起着至关重要的作用.该文参考当前在指令集仿真领域比较先进的JIT-CCS和IS-CS仿真技术,吸取了各自的一些优点,提出了仿真策略,设计并实现了基于DSP3000的指令集仿真器HJS.为了兼顾仿真速度与精度的要求,HJS实现了指令精度和时钟周期精度两种级别的仿真.同时,在指令Cache和流水线的仿真上都做到了既尽可能与实际硬件相符,同时也兼顾执行效率.为评估DSP硬件设计、DSP算法的实现提供了很好的软件模拟平台. 相似文献
8.
利用C++Builder与Matlab实现实时数据的获取与处理 总被引:2,自引:1,他引:1
针对航空电气系统实时数据采集环境的复杂性,介绍了采用PC机模拟航空电子公管系统,利用C++Builder完成人机交互界面的设计以及数据的获取与处理;在Borland C++Builder 6环境下,利用其功能强大的图形化控制界面,及MSComm控件在串行口下编程,实现上位机与DSP的SCI通讯模块的通讯;结合Matlab实现供电系统设备状态数据的处理,并通过建立Access数据库,在BCB6中实时存储处理供电系统的各部分状态信息。 相似文献
9.
针对传统机器人控制系统存在的跨平台开发和部署问题,提出了一种基于ROS(Robot Operating System,机器人操作系统)网桥的跨平台网络化人机交互系统。构建以Node.js框架为服务后端,Bootstrap框架和jQuery组件为交互前端的网络化控制系统架构,通过ROS网桥技术实现万维网(World Wide Web, WWW)端和机器人端的跨平台数据互通,并按需进行机器人控制服务化调用。实验结果表明,该控制系统能够实现机器人端环境感知、状态监视、远程控制等功能,支持个人电脑(Personal Computer, PC)端、移动端等泛平台人机交互,具有可模块化敏捷开发、移植扩展性强等优点。 相似文献
10.
基于DSP和单片机的双CPU数据处理系统 总被引:13,自引:0,他引:13
基于现实中很多嵌入式系统要求处理器实时处理数据或者实现复杂算法的同时还要能完成各种控制任务,提出了一种基于TMS320VC5402DSP和AT89C51单片机构建的双CPU数据处理系统的设计方案,充分发挥出DSP的数据处理能力和单片机的外围接口控制能力。文中详细介绍了该系统中DSP存储器的配置以及DSP与单片机通信接口的设计,给出了软硬件的实现方法。系统还设计了液晶显示模块和键盘模块作为人机交互接口,给出了硬件接口原理图,对软件编程的实现也做了探讨。目前该方案正实施于一个舰载智能接口箱的开发项目。 相似文献
11.
短波宽带接收机是短波接收领域近年来研究的热点,接收信道化处理则是其中一个非常重要的环节。传统短波宽带接收机以硬件划分信道为主,无法实时处理大量的宽带信号。该文提出软件结合硬件来实现宽带信号中子信道划分,采用多相滤波算法实现信道化,它具有动态范围大,实现效率高等优点,并利用两种不同的软件进行信道化仿真,分别显示了普通滤波器组和多相滤波器组对较理想多个信号的信道化效果。并对所得到的结果进行了分析。在使用DSP仿真软件实现信道化时,要考虑到硬件的实际情况,可采用Visual DSP++自带的代码性能分析工具来评价代码的性能,提高处理信号的实时性。 相似文献
12.
FIR滤波器的FPGA实现及其仿真研究 总被引:4,自引:11,他引:4
本文提出了一种采用现场可编程门阵列器件FPGA实现FIR字滤波器硬件电路的方案,该方案基于只读存储器ROM查找表的分布式算法。并以一个十六阶低通FIR数字滤波电路在ALTERA公司的CYCLONE系列FPGA芯片上的实现为例说明了设计过程。所设计电路通过软件验证和硬件仿真,结果表明电路工作正确可靠,满足设计要求,性能优于用DSP和传统方法实现的FIR滤波器。 相似文献
13.
14.
基于DSP和FPGA的通用型伺服控制器设计 总被引:1,自引:0,他引:1
介绍了一种采用浮点型DSP和FPGA芯片设计的高性能伺服控制器,详细讨论了其硬件和软件设计方案.DSP强大的数据处理能力与FPGA的设计灵活性相结合,使该控制器适用于多种应用场合,尤其是采用复杂控制算法的高速、高精度同步控制系统. 相似文献
15.
介绍了基于TI的视频应用芯片TMS320DM642的二维码识读器的设计方法.使用TVP5102和SAA7104进行输入图像的采集和回放,重点讲解了DM642模块、视频输入接口和视频输出接口的硬件设计结构.并介绍了基于DSP/BIOS的视频采集驱动程序编写、程序流程、图像处理方法以及CCS中DSP/BIOS配置工具、CSL和FVID的使用. 相似文献
16.
17.
A novel majority based imprecise 4:2 compressor with respect to the current and future VLSI industry
Imprecising the arithmetic hardware blocks is well known as one of the brilliant approaches that increase the performance of digital signal processors (DSP) at the cost of imposing some acceptable errors. Making a trade-off between the performance and the enormous results of a given system is a challenge which has attracted the interest of many researchers in recent years. In this paper, we focus on the design of an imprecise 4:2 compressor which lies at the heart of inexact multipliers. The proposed imprecise 4:2 compressor by utilizing only one majority gate brings significant efficiency in implementation of today's technologies like FinFET and future majority based emerging technologies such as QCA. The evaluation results in both of aforesaid technologies demonstrate the remarkable improvement of the proposed design compared to related works. In addition, employing the proposed imprecise 4:2 compressor in an image processing application confirms the qualitative acceptability of the proposed design. 相似文献
18.
19.
基于DSP的足球机器人控制电路设计 总被引:2,自引:0,他引:2
从改善足球机器人控制电路性能的目的出发,分析了用普通单片机控制的足球机器人在比赛中的缺陷,对普通单片机和DSP芯片两种控制芯片的性能作了简单的比较,详细介绍了用美国德州仪器(TI)公司生产的TMS320LF2407A芯片作为电路控制芯片,设计足球机器人控制电路的方法。并在实际控制过程中采用PID算法。实现了足球机器人软件控制与硬件的结合。成功地把基于DSP的足球机器人应用于实际的比赛中,实际效果显示与基于普通单片机的机器人相比,性能有了较大的提高,对机器人的控制可以得到更令人满意的结果。 相似文献
20.
故障电弧早期预测预警系统研究 总被引:1,自引:0,他引:1
根据开关柜内部故障电弧伴生放电声的频谱特性,提出基于三层小波包分解的频带能量特征弧声识别算法,构建基于DSP的故障电弧早期预警系统,给出了系统的软硬件设计方案,并就系统设计中弧声信号的获取、滤波及其智能识别算法中特征参数阈值选取等一些关键问题进行重点研究;该系统相当于给传统的故障电弧保护机制扩展了预测预警功能,有利于将故障电弧消除在事故发生之前;实验结果表明:系统运行正常,可准确、快速发出预警. 相似文献